Do you build native (Swift/Kotlin) or cross-platform apps?

We build cross-platform apps with React Native. For 95% of use cases, React Native delivers native-quality performance and user experience at significantly lower cost than two separate native codebases. For the rare use cases requiring hardware-level access or extreme performance (AR, heavy video processing), we evaluate native development separately.

How long does mobile app development take?

A focused MVP with core features typically takes 6–10 weeks. A full-featured app with complex integrations, admin dashboards, and thorough QA takes 12–20 weeks. We define scope precisely before committing to a timeline.

Can you add mobile to our existing web product?

Yes. If your web product has a well-structured API, adding a React Native mobile app is straightforward. We evaluate the existing API during discovery and flag any changes needed to support mobile-specific requirements (push notifications, offline sync, etc.).
